There is one immutable truth to Halloween candies: they are all bad for you says guest blogger. Chicago-area dentist. He doesn't be to spoil your fun but he does want you to know that some are worse than others. To help. Mantis has separated Halloween candies into five distinct types and rated on a scale from 1-10 (1 being good for your teeth. 10 being the absolute worst cavity-causers) their proclivity for causing cavities. Taffy and hard dulcify are the two worst offenders. Use this Halloween command to safeguarding your children's teeth. Mantis says but. "as always be wary of excess consumption of any trickery treat." Taffy worry Factor Score: 9 out of 10"Traditionally dentists undergo always known that the longer a food sticks to the teeth the longer bacteria has to cater on it to create cavity-causing acid," Mantis said. "One of the best ways to forbid cavities during Halloween is to forbid the sticky candy that can cover your teeth and fasten itself into the nooks and crannies of your mouth." Hard CandyFear Factor Score: 8.5 out of 10"Although hard candies like Jaw Breakers and Everlasting Gobstoppers don't have that stick factor they hurt your mouth from the be of measure they take to change state," Mantis said. "The longer food sits in your communicate the more acidic the environment becomes." "People naturally assume that if they can't feel the candy sticking to their mouths they are okay but that isn't adjust. If you leave a hard candy in your communicate for a lengthy period of time this can be even worse than a sticky candy." Peanut cover CupsFear Factor advance: 6.5 out of 10"Safer than candies desire taffy the ever-present peanut butter cup is comfort a hazard to your communicate," Mantis said. "Studies undergo indicated that chocolate is especially good at creating acid buildup in your mouth and the stickiness of peanut cover doesn't help." Candy-Covered ChocolateFear calculate Score: 6 out of 10"Most people anticipate that when chocolate lacks the sticky peanut butter it has to be better for their teeth," Mantis said. "Again while it lacks that evaluate it suffers from the time factor. Candy-covered chocolate is typically consumed in a bag where the consumer is continually chewing on the candy. While a peanut cover cup is typically consumed in one or two bites a bag of M&M’s can measure for minutes. This extra measure gives the bacteria plenty of time to generate cavity causing acid." dulcify SticksFear calculate Score: 5 out of 10"Most parents automatically fling out their kids' Pixie Stix with the assumption that a little bag of sugar must be awful for teeth," Mantis said."Contrary to popular belief these little sacks of sugar are some of the safest Halloween treats out there. Pixie Stix are typically poured directly onto the tongue avoiding chewing and your teeth altogether. They are then quickly consumed and out of the mouth before any major alter can been done. So while it may not make sense those sacks of dulcify may be the best candy for your teeth. •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• • •

THIS exclusive artist's impression shows what a new £6.5m football centre and health club being built on the outskirts of York ordain look desire. The complex which will act between 75 and 100 jobs is under construction just off the York outer go road close to the former ikon/diva site at Clifton Moor. It is on land which was once named as a possible location for a York City stadium. The new PlayFootball place which will have six dedicated five-a-side pitches two all-weather larger training facilities changing rooms and sports bar is due to open in February. The Roko health club which will be up and running in April will boast a state-of-the-art fitness area. 20m heated indoor share and children's share spa and relaxation facilities a health and beauty suite creche and café and outdoor hit tennis courts. York ordain be PlayFootball's ninth place in the UK while Roko has other centres in Portsmouth. Gillingham. Bournemouth and Nottingham.
